Logging in with Administratively Configured Account

If the device's default user account settings have been changed, proceed as follows:
1. At the login prompt, enter your administratively-assigned user name and press ENTER.
2. At the Password prompt, enter your password and press ENTER.

Using a Telnet Connection

Once the Matrix Series device has a valid IP address, you can establish a Telnet session from any
TCP/IP based node on the network as follows.
1. Telnet to the device's IP address.
2. Enter login (user name) and password information in one of the following ways:
